Astro & Safari
Front
  • Drain cooling system into suitable container.
  • Remove heater hoses.
  • Remove screws that retain cover to heater case assembly.
  • Remove straps that retain heater core to heater case assembly.
  • Remove heater core from vehicle.
  • Reverse procedure to install.

The Sensing and Diagnostic Module (SDM) can maintain enough voltage to cause air bag deployment for up to 10 minutes after the ignition is turned Off and the battery is disconnected. Servicing the Supplemental air bag (SIR) system during this period may result in accidental deployment and personal injury.

Astro & Safari
Front
  • Remove air cleaner assembly.
  • Disconnect electrical connector, then remove recovery and windshield washer fluid reservoir assembly.
  • Remove two acoustic cover retaining screws in blower motor area.
  • Cut acoustic cover between five clip lands, Fig. . Retain piece of acoustic cover for reassembly.
  • Remove cooling tube from motor.
  • Remove blower motor to case attaching screws.
  • Remove blower motor from case.
  • Reverse procedure install.
